      Meaning of the first name Waylon

      Origin

      English

      Meaning

      Land by the road

      Variations

      Gaylon, Jaylon, Gaylonn
      The name Waylon has its origins in the English language and is derived from the words land and road. Its etymology suggests that it refers to someone who lives by the road or perhaps even owns land in close proximity to a road. This name has a historical background that can be traced back several centuries. It likely originated as a name, denoting the family or ancestral connection to a specific location along a road or near a thoroughfare.

      In modern-day usage, the name Waylon is primarily employed as a first name rather than a name. With an English origin and a meaning related to land and roads, Waylon has gained popularity as a given name in various English-speaking countries. Its usage has particularly increased in the United States over the past century. Waylon Jennings, a prominent figure in American country music, helped popularize the name with his successful career in the 20th century. Today, Waylon remains an appealing choice for parents looking for a strong and masculine name with a touch of history and connection to the land.
